Built for flagship performance

Whether you spend most of your time gaming, editing videos or simply juggling multiple apps, performance is one area where the Galaxy S25 Ultra aims to impress. At its core is the Snapdragon 8 Elite for Galaxy, Qualcomm’s flagship chipset, customised for Samsung’s premium smartphones.

​The processor is paired with hardware that’s capable of comfortably handling intensive workloads, making the phone equally suited for productivity and entertainment.

Camera system designed for creators

Samsung has equipped the Galaxy S25 Ultra with a 200MP primary camera backed by the AI ProVisual Engine, which works behind the scenes to enhance image processing and preserve detail across varying lighting conditions.

​Video recording also gets meaningful upgrades. The smartphone supports Nightography Video for improved low-light footage, while 10-bit HDR recording helps capture richer colours and better contrast for videos that look more natural.

Galaxy AI adds useful everyday features

Rather than adding AI just for the sake of it, Samsung has introduced features that can be genuinely useful in day-to-day use. Take Audio Eraser, for instance. It can minimise unwanted background sounds in compatible videos, making voices stand out more clearly. Then there’s Now Brief and Now Bar, which surface useful updates and information throughout the day, reducing the need to constantly open different apps.

Premium design with improved durability

The Galaxy S25 Ultra combines flagship hardware with a durable design. It features a Titanium Frame for added strength while maintaining a premium in-hand feel. Samsung has also equipped the device with Corning Gorilla Armor 2 display glass, offering improved durability for everyday use.
